However, not everything is perfect yet.
At the very beginning, I selected Russian language.
So after rebuut and starting base-config, it tried to display messages in
Russian. However, it didn't configure console to display cyrillic, so
russian text was unreadable.

The easy way to configure cyrillic console in Debian is the console-cyrillic
package. So it seems to be a good solution to install it before base-config
runs, and to use it to configure cyrillic console before running
base-config if installation language requires that. Is that possible?
